Prince Harry is preparing to return to London later this month but the trip is already being overshadowed by a familiar absence that continues to raise eyebrows. Once again the Duke of Sussex will arrive without Meghan Markle and their children reinforcing a growing pattern that has quietly defined the couple’s relationship with Britain.
Meghan will remain in California with Prince Archie and Princess Lilibet extending a separation that has now lasted more than three years when it comes to UK visits. The Duchess of Sussex has not set foot in Britain since Queen Elizabeth’s funeral in September 2022 while the children were last seen during the Platinum Jubilee earlier that same year.
Since stepping back from royal duties Prince Harry has returned to the UK multiple times on his own. From court appearances to charity events and ceremonial occasions he has navigated his homeland solo while his family stays firmly based in the United States.
Royal watchers say the optics are becoming increasingly difficult to ignore. Every solo visit adds to speculation about deep rooted issues ranging from security fears to unresolved family tensions and Meghan Markle’s continued reluctance to face the British public again.
This latest trip is expected to be serious rather than sentimental. Prince Harry is preparing for another High Court showdown in his long running legal battle against Associated Newspapers Limited the publisher behind the Daily Mail Mail on Sunday and MailOnline.
The case has been ongoing for years and centres on allegations of unlawful information gathering. It has become one of the most defining chapters of Harry’s post royal life tying him repeatedly back to the UK through the courts rather than through family reconciliation.
Despite the legal significance of the visit there are no signs of a broader family reunion. Archie and Lilibet are not expected to travel and there has been no indication of private meetings with senior royals beyond what is strictly necessary.

King Charles has only met his granddaughter Lilibet once when she was just six months old during the Sussexes brief return for the Platinum Jubilee in 2022. Since then birthdays milestones and everyday moments have passed across the Atlantic.
Sources suggest contact between Harry and his father remains limited and carefully managed. While there have been occasional brief encounters there has been no sustained effort to rebuild the closeness that once defined their relationship.
The absence of Meghan Markle continues to fuel debate. Supporters argue her decision is rooted in safety concerns and emotional wellbeing while critics claim it reflects a deeper unwillingness to reconnect with the UK and the royal family.
Security has long been cited as a major factor. Prince Harry has repeatedly stated that he does not feel safe bringing his wife and children to Britain without guaranteed police protection an issue still tied up in legal proceedings and Home Office decisions.
Yet others believe the distance goes beyond logistics. Meghan’s last appearance in Britain was during a period of intense scrutiny and grief following the late Queen’s death and some insiders say she has little desire to reopen that chapter.
Public perception also plays a role. Every solo appearance by Harry revives conversations about Megxit royal rifts and whether the couple are truly aligned when it comes to their future relationship with the monarchy.
As Prince Harry prepares to land in London once more the focus is not just on the courtroom battle ahead but on the growing reality that his homecomings no longer resemble a family affair. For many royal watchers the silence from Meghan Markle speaks louder than any statement.
